....is directed against the order of the Deputy Excise and Taxation Commissioner (Appeals), Ambala City, whereby the sale of moong dal amounting to Rs. 2,92,000 was assessed to sales tax at the rate of 5 naye paise under the second proviso to section 5(2)(a)(ii) of the Punjab General Sales Tax Act, 1948. The sale in question was before the amendment of the form of the registration certificate.   ....
